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$130.25 | 5.852% | $137.8722 | $137.87 | $137.85 | $137.90 |
Purchase #2 | $104.34 | 7.562% | $112.2302 | $112.23 | $112.25 | $112.20 |
Purchase #3 | $32.91 | 13.407% | $37.3222 | $37.32 | $37.30 | $37.30 |
Purchase #4 | $172.54 | 9.230% | $188.4654 | $188.47 | $188.45 | $188.50 |
Purchase #5 | $193.38 | 4.409% | $201.9061 | $201.91 | $201.90 | $201.90 |
Purchase #6 | $249.65 | 5.577% | $263.573 | $263.57 | $263.55 | $263.60 |
Purchase #7 | $218.78 | 4.388% | $228.3801 | $228.38 | $228.40 | $228.40 |
7 purchase totals = | $1,101.85 | $1,169.7492 | $1,169.75 | $1,169.70 | $1,169.80 |
